在使用Ansible的命令行工具ansibleansible-playbook时,可以通过-m参数指定要使用的模块,通过-a参数指定模块的参数。对于fetch模块,你可以使用以下命令来拉取受控主机的/var/log目录并保存到指定的路径和名称:

ansible <主机组> -m fetch -a "src=/var/log/ dest=<保存路径/保存文件名> flat=yes"

其中,需要替换以下内容:

  • <主机组>: 指定受控主机的主机组名称,可以是单个主机或主机组的名称。
  • <保存路径/保存文件名>: 指定保存路径和文件名的值,例如/tmp/logs.tar.gz

请确保在运行命令之前已经配置好Ansible的主机清单文件,其中包含要操作的受控主机。

ansible的adoc命令行使用fetch模块拉取受控主机varlog要求使用flat参数指定保存路径及名称

原文地址: https://www.cveoy.top/t/topic/i5Ws 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录